Take a moment to consider your website. If you are like most professionals, your website probably talks about all the different practices you focus on, the different topics of discussion, and maybe even multiple practice areas that are completely unrelated.
If you consider this from your prospect's view, it's almost certainly overwhelming. Not only can they NOT find the terms they understand (you have dissolution, they know divorce; you have Intellectual Property, they know trade secrets; etc.), the typical website has a minimum of 10 practice areas.
But what if you considered things from the prospect-client point of view? What if you made everything you do simple to understand and not loaded with a dozen or more practice areas?
The fact is, we've seen a growing trend emerging – the pursuit of a niche within a practice area. This strategic approach is proving to be a powerful avenue for legal professionals seeking increased success.
Here are 8 good reasons why you might want to rethink much of how your practice is presented.
Expertise Commands Authority:
One of the primary advantages of carving a niche is the opportunity to position oneself as an authority in that specific area. When you concentrate your efforts on a specific area of law - the niche - you naturally become more knowledgeable and experienced within that niche. This heightened expertise lends credibility to your practice, making you the go-to source for clients seeking assistance in that particular field. It creates a virtuous cycle where your specialization attracts more clients, providing you with more hands-on experience, which, in turn, further solidifies your authority.
Targeted Marketing:
Niche specialization allows for precise and efficient marketing efforts. Instead of adopting a broad, one-size-fits-all approach, you can tailor your marketing strategies to directly target the audience interested in your specialized services. This targeted approach not only optimizes your marketing budget but also ensures that your message resonates more effectively with potential clients looking for specific expertise. Whether through online channels, networking events, or content marketing, the focused nature of niche marketing often yields higher returns on investment.
Reduced Competition:
The legal landscape is highly competitive, with law practices vying for attention in oversaturated markets. By narrowing your focus to a niche, you inherently reduce the competition you face. Instead of competing with a myriad of generalist practices, you position yourself as a specialist, distinguishing your services from the rest. This distinctiveness not only makes your practice more memorable but also increases the likelihood of attracting clients seeking specialized expertise, giving you a competitive edge.
Enhanced Client Relationships:
Specialization fosters deeper connections with clients. When clients seek legal assistance, they often prefer attorneys who demonstrate a profound understanding of their unique challenges. By specializing, you align yourself with clients who specifically need your expertise, leading to more meaningful and enduring relationships. This targeted alignment builds trust, as clients perceive you as someone who intimately understands their concerns and can provide tailored solutions.
Efficiency and Mastery:
Covering a broad range of practice areas can lead to spreading resources thinly and diluting your proficiency. A focused niche allows you to channel your resources, time, and energy more efficiently. As you hone your skills in a specific area, you achieve mastery, making your practice more adept at handling intricate legal matters within that niche. This mastery contributes to higher success rates, client satisfaction, and a reputation for excellence in your chosen field.
Adaptability to Legal Trends:
The legal landscape is dynamic, with laws and regulations constantly evolving. In a niche practice, it becomes more feasible to stay abreast of the latest legal trends and changes specific to your area of expertise. This adaptability positions your practice as an informed and proactive player in your field, allowing you to offer clients cutting-edge solutions based on the latest developments.
Maximized Referral Opportunities:
A specialized practice is more likely to receive referrals from other professionals and even competing firms. When colleagues encounter cases outside their specialization, they often refer clients to specialists in that particular area. By establishing your practice as a niche expert, you open the door to increased referral opportunities, expanding your client base through collaborative efforts within the legal community.
Strategic Fee Structuring:
Specialized knowledge commands premium fees. Clients recognize the added value of working with an expert in their specific legal challenge, allowing you to structure your fees strategically. The perceived value of your specialized services often justifies higher billing rates, contributing to the financial sustainability and growth of your practice.
Carving out a niche allows law practices to thrive in a competitive environment, positioning themselves as authorities, enhancing client relationships, and fostering efficient growth. Embracing a specialized focus not only benefits the practitioners but also serves the clients by providing them with unparalleled expertise and tailored legal solutions.
